What we usually add to another bill because it's unlikely to pass on its own would be a rider - a.
When we add riders to bills, we're hoping that these riders will increase the likelihood of the bill being passed where all the parties involved would also be happy about the recent changes (Which came from the rider).

Crossing situation is very common with boat. The stand-on vessel should maintain its course and speed.
<h3>What is Crossing situation?</h3>
This is simply known to be a situation where give-way vessel must act to so as to avoid a collision.
It often include altering of its course to pass astern of the stand-on vessel or slowing down or simply do both things. The stand-on vessel should then maintain its course and speed.
